Rift

Typical rift within a landscape.

Rifts are one-way portals between Elyos and Asmodian zones.

Rifting mechanics have been changed multiple times. As of 4.0 rifts spawn based on fixed schedule, last for 1 hour and have no level limits.

Each rift has fixed entrance location, but 2-3 possible spawn locations for exits.

Rifts do not spawn on the Fast-Track Server.

Quests

Daily defense quests

Daily quests for killing enemy intruders are available whenever you enter a zone with open incoming rifts.

  • Kills only count while the rifts are open.
  • Kills don't count in alliance.
  • Pink players (10 levels lower than you) do count.

As a reward you get Ancient Crown Bundle and Elysea Defense Medal Bundle (Asmodae Defense Medal Bundle). Crown Bundle drops random crown, while Medal Bundle has level-dependent drops:

Guards

While rifts are open, NPC guards may randomly spawn at certain locations. Guards with "Elite" in their name drop either a crown or <Mithril Medal>. Non-elite guards drop <Major Ancient Crown>, <Mithril Medal>, <Greater Divine Life Serum> or <Greater Divine Mana Serum>. Guards despawn if their designated rift despawns.

Dimensional vortex

3.5 update introduced dimensional vortexes — limited version of rifts to Theobomos and Brusthonin.

Curse

Killing enemy on their territory gives character curse points. Those aren't shown anywhere, but after getting certain amount of points player receives a Curse debuff, which significantly reduces character speed, stats, shows his location with a skull on the map for every enemy player and prevents further usage of rifts until the curse is gone. Killing low level players gives you more curse points. Debuff has no effect in disputed and home zones. Staying online in those zones is the only way to reduce your curse points and get rid of the debuff.

Properties

Rift A from Heiron, as well as rifts A and G from Beluslan have 2 possible exit locations. All the other rifts have 3 exit locations.

Each rift can be used limited number of times.

Eltnen and Morheim A B C D E F G
Capacity 24 35 35 35 40 40 40
Heiron and Beluslan A B C D E F G
Capacity 24 40 48 48 60 72 144
Inggison and Gelkmaros A B C D
Capacity 150

Although normally all the rifts pop at scheduled hour, on rare occasions one of the entrances may not spawn.
